Ballintubber Heritage Tour

Last Summer, a group of 75 students and academic staff from American colleges arrived in Ballintubber to stay and work on a month-long project Archaeological Field School on Ballintubber Castle, as part of the Castles in Communities project. This was the third year that the project has taken place in Ballintubber and to celebrate and document the activities and events taking place, the Community and Enterprise Department of Roscommon County Council commissioned a series of short films about this wonderfully unique project under the banner Real Roscommon. 


During the month of July, film producers Mimar Media spent time with the students, staff and locals, to document how this small community in county Roscommon have reached out and opened their village and way of life to overseas visitors for a whole month.


The short films capture a flavour of why this Castles in Communities project in Ballintubber works - the uniqueness of the students being embedded in the community for a month and how this experience reflects upon the locals and students alike.
